I have been enthralled with Bodegas Volver since my visit a few years ago.
Here is the vineyard where this wine comes from, as you can see dry framed and 100% un-grafted Monastrell that dates back to 1935,
planted in the Alicante region of Spain.

That’s not a pyramid in the background but the largest marble quarry in Europe.
It is located near their vineyards, testament to the chalky quality of the soils, which is perfect for the vines. Marble is the product of chalk, or calcium carbonate that has been compressed over a very long period of time.

Our Thoughts on this wine.....

Traditional dry farmed viticulture, cultivated completely by hand, with minimal human intervention. This is the work of Jorge Ordonez, and his name is synonymous with the best wines of Spain. The style here is ripe & powerful. Cherry color with a hint of intense ruby. In the nose mature fruit, raspberries, blueberries, spices, hints of balsamic and notes of flowers. Tasty in the mouth, balanced and full-bodied. Long finish. Only 7000 cases made.

Rafael Cañizares
The project of Bodegas Volver was founded in 2004 by Rafael Cañizares, enologist through studies and viticulturist through his family tradition of four generations bound to the vine and wine. The pillars of the bodega are based on the repositioning of quality Spanish wines and recovering old indigenous vineyards which, either through low production or lack of generational succession, had been lost.

Our most prized asset is our heritage of vines between 30 and 90 years old, indigenous varieties cultivated in a sustainable way with minimal intervention. We create wines under different denominations of origin; La Mancha, Alicante, Jumilla and Rueda.
